Sign Up

Sign Up to our social questions and Answers Engine to ask questions, answer people’s questions, and connect with other people.

Have an account? Sign In

Have an account? Sign In Now

Sign In

Login to our social questions & Answers Engine to ask questions answer people’s questions & connect with other people.

Sign Up Here

Forgot Password?

Don't have account, Sign Up Here

Forgot Password

Lost your password? Please enter your email address. You will receive a link and will create a new password via email.

Have an account? Sign In Now

You must login to ask a question.

Forgot Password?

Need An Account, Sign Up Here

Please briefly explain why you feel this question should be reported.

Please briefly explain why you feel this answer should be reported.

Please briefly explain why you feel this user should be reported.

Sign InSign Up

The Archive Base

The Archive Base Logo The Archive Base Logo

The Archive Base Navigation

  • SEARCH
  • Home
  • About Us
  • Blog
  • Contact Us
Search
Ask A Question

Mobile menu

Close
Ask a Question
  • Home
  • Add group
  • Groups page
  • Feed
  • User Profile
  • Communities
  • Questions
    • New Questions
    • Trending Questions
    • Must read Questions
    • Hot Questions
  • Polls
  • Tags
  • Badges
  • Buy Points
  • Users
  • Help
  • Buy Theme
  • SEARCH
Home/ Questions/Q 7822083
In Process

The Archive Base Latest Questions

Editorial Team
  • 0
Editorial Team
Asked: June 2, 20262026-06-02T07:49:31+00:00 2026-06-02T07:49:31+00:00

This is the line of code I’m using, which is causing the problem: [self.managedObjectContext

  • 0

This is the line of code I’m using, which is causing the problem:

[self.managedObjectContext deleteObject:object];

And then when it saves the context, it causes the crash:

Terminating app due to uncaught exception 'NSObjectInaccessibleException', reason: 'CoreData could not fulfill a fault'

EDIT: Running the code with ‘-com.apple.CoreData.SQLDebug 1’.

CoreData: sql: BEGIN EXCLUSIVE
CoreData: sql: DELETE FROM ZENTRY WHERE Z_PK = ? AND Z_OPT = ?
CoreData: sql: COMMIT
CoreData: sql: SELECT 0, t0.Z_PK, t0.Z_OPT, t0.ZCREATIONDATE, t0.ZMESSAGE, t0.ZSECTIONIDENTIFIER, t0.ZVERSION FROM ZENTRY t0 WHERE  t0.Z_PK = ? 
CoreData: annotation: sql connection fetch time: 0.0042s
CoreData: annotation: total fetch execution time: 0.0096s for 0 rows.
    CoreData: annotation: fault fulfilled from database for : 0x209010 <x-coredata://[edited out long code here]/Entry/p34>
 *** Terminating app due to uncaught exception 'NSObjectInaccessibleException', reason: 'CoreData could not fulfill a fault'

Not sure if this is any help in finding where the problem lies?

  • 1 1 Answer
  • 0 Views
  • 0 Followers
  • 0
Share
  • Facebook
  • Report

Leave an answer
Cancel reply

You must login to add an answer.

Forgot Password?

Need An Account, Sign Up Here

1 Answer

  • Voted
  • Oldest
  • Recent
  • Random
  1. Editorial Team
    Editorial Team
    2026-06-02T07:49:33+00:00Added an answer on June 2, 2026 at 7:49 am

    I think you need to provide a bit more “context” for this question.

    However, there are a few places to look for your problem. First, are you using multiple ManagedObject Contexts? If so, make sure self.managedObjectContext is the same as object.managedObjectContext.

    Are you using multiple threads? If so, then you must be using multiple MOCs. Make sure you are only using a MOC on “its” thread.

    If you are using the containment policy, that means using the MOC on the thread you created it. If one of the other two, then you should be executing MOC code within performBlock or performBlockAndWait.

    Grab the object id of the object being saved, and see if it is in the SQL file.

    You can turn on the core data sql debugging flag (add “-com.apple.CoreData.SQLDebug 1” to arguments passed on launch in the scheme) and watch the SQL statements log to console as your app runs. It can help you track down what’s really happening.

    I think that’s enough for now…

    EDIT

    Some other debugging stuff…

    With the context, dump all it’s idea of state. inserted/deleted/registered/updated objects, propogatesDeletesAtaaendOfEvent, retainsRegisteredObjects, etc…

    Basically, these types of problems are very difficult to track down without lots of information, especially if you are only using one thread and one MOC… because most issues result from using multiple MOCs and/or threads.

    • 0
    • Reply
    • Share
      Share
      • Share on Facebook
      • Share on Twitter
      • Share on LinkedIn
      • Share on WhatsApp
      • Report

Sidebar

Related Questions

Got this line of code here but its not working. private void Button_Click(object sender,
This line of code causes the exceptions shown below: object arg = methodCallMessage.Args[i]; private
This line of code is in AController.m UIBarButtonItem *addButton = [[UIBarButtonItem alloc] initWithBarButtonSystemItem:UIBarButtonSystemItemAdd target:self
I have seen this line of code in several tutorials for using Unity in
Apparently this line of code is triggering Object expected: var bPid = (b !=
i have this line of code in my view using the Telerik Grid: columns.Bound(o
I am using this line of code to dispaly a string with an int
Why doesn't this line of code work? ['fdfsd','gfdhgf'].inject(Hash.new){|sum,e| sum[e] = e} Using ruby-1.9.2-p180, got
I have this line of code that returns index of particular object in a
I've got this line of code which set daylight saving On what would be

Explore

  • Home
  • Add group
  • Groups page
  • Communities
  • Questions
    • New Questions
    • Trending Questions
    • Must read Questions
    • Hot Questions
  • Polls
  • Tags
  • Badges
  • Users
  • Help
  • SEARCH

Footer

© 2021 The Archive Base. All Rights Reserved
With Love by The Archive Base

Insert/edit link

Enter the destination URL

Or link to existing content

    No search term specified. Showing recent items. Search or use up and down arrow keys to select an item.